The Klez Worm: A Wake-Up Call for Email Security
This morning, security researchers are responding to the rapid spread of the Klez worm, a major threat that is significantly impacting email systems across the globe. This malware, which first emerged late last year, is exploiting vulnerabilities in email applications to propagate itself, causing widespread infections that threaten both individual users and organizations alike.
The Klez worm family, with its various strains, has been observed to utilize social engineering tactics to trick users into opening infected email attachments. This tactic is particularly effective as it disguises itself with convincing subject lines and sender names, often appearing to come from trusted contacts. As the worm spreads, it not only compromises the victim’s system but also utilizes their email address to send out further copies, creating a vicious cycle of infection.
